Emergency Tarping to Prevent Further Damage in Hartford County

When you contact for emergency roofing during bad weather, the first thing we do is lay a protective covering on your roof. This is to prevent further harm to your business building’s interior and structure.

We offer emergency tarping to cover the hole in the roof until the weather improves. We can then inspect the damage completely, make the required repairs, and potentially assist you with your insurance claim.

Corrugated Roof

Roofs can be made of anything, metal (aluminum, cooper, zinc, tin, galvanized iron), and clay or ceramic (tile, slate or shingle). The type of roofing products you want to cover and safeguard your home depends on your taste, viability on the home structure and budget plan.

aesthetic and practical. Some corrugated roofing products are made from metal others are polycarbonate. Corrugated roof is generally used for steep slope roofing. It might be paint-coated with various colors and treated with metal preserving chemicals to make it more resistant and long lasting from destructive compounds.

Some materials are highly corrosion resistant. Fiberglass and metal corrugated roof materials are both thin and lightweight, which makes them unfavorable since they can be detached quickly by strong winds. Throughout heavy rains this roof product ends up being loud as beads of rain touch the roofing's surface area.

When buying this type of roofing product, careful planning must be taken into account. Installing the material is reasonably workable, considering that the material is a long sheet of metal, attaching them to the wood frame or purlin will be extremely easy.

Flat Roofs

Flat roofings are a great method to keep a building safe from water. Understanding exactly what to do with a flat roof will ensure you have a working roofing system that will last a very long time.

They may look great, and are really typical, flat roofing systems do require regular maintenance and comprehensive repair work in order to efficiently prevent water infiltration. You'll be happy with your flat roofing for an extremely long time if this is done correctly.

Flat roofings aren't as popular and/or attractive as its more recent equivalents, such as tile, slate, or copper roofs. However, they are just as essential and require much more attention. In order to prevent throwing away cash on short-term repairs, you ought to know exactly how flat roofing systems are developed, the various types of flat roofing systems that are offered, and the importance of routine evaluation and upkeep.

A flat roofing system works by offering a waterproof membrane over a structure. It consists of one or more layers of hydrophobic products that is positioned over a structural deck with a vapor barrier that is usually positioned between the roofing system and the deck membrane.

Flashing, or thin strips of material such as copper, converge with the membrane and the other structure parts to avoid water infiltration. The water is then directed to drains, downspouts, and gutters by the roof's slight pitch.

There are 4 most common kinds of flat roofing system systems. Listed in order of increasing resilience and cost, they are: roll asphalt, single-ply membrane, multiple-ply or built-up, and flat-seamed metal. They can range anywhere from as low as $2 per square foot for roll asphalt or single-ply roofing that is used over and existing roof, to $20 per square foot or more for brand-new metal roofs.

Utilized considering that the 1890s, asphalt roll roofing normally includes one layer of asphalt-saturated organic or fiberglass base felts that are used over roofing system felt with nails and cold asphalt cement and generally covered with a granular mineral surface. The joints are typically covered over with a roofing substance. It can last about 10 years.

Single-ply membrane roof is the latest kind of roofing product. It is typically utilized to replace multiple-ply roofs. 10 to 12 year service warranties are common, but proper setup is vital and upkeep is still needed.

Multiple-ply or built-up roof, likewise referred to as BUR, is made from overlapping rolls of saturated or covered felts or mats that are sprinkled with layers of bitumen and appeared with a granular roof tile, sheet, or ballast pavers that are utilized to safeguard the underlying materials from the weather condition. BURs are created to last 10 to 30 years, which depends on the products used.

Ballast, or aggregate, of crushed stone or water-worn gravel is embedded in a covering of asphalt or coal tar. Because the ballast or tile pavers cover the membrane, it makes inspecting and keeping the seams of the roof challenging.

Last but not least, flat-seamed roofings have actually been utilized given that the 19 th century. Made from small pieces of sheet metal soldered flush at the joints, it can last lots of decades depending upon the quality of the exposure, upkeep, and material to the components.

Galvanized metal does need routine painting in order to prevent corrosion and split seams need to be resoldered. Other metal surface areas, such as copper, can end up being pitted and pinholed from acid raid and usually needs changing. Today copper, lead-coated copper, and terne-coated stainless-steel are preferred as long-lasting flat roofings.
